<p><strong>CORALVILLE - </strong>Day 1 of the state volleyball tournament wrapped up Monday night with a pair of matches in Class 4A. Pella and North Scott advanced to the semifinals with four-set wins.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>North Scott finished up its competition first. The [program_tooltip program_id='431978' first='Lancers' last=''] eked out a 27-25, first set win against Dallas Center-Grimes before dropping the second, 25-17. They recovered for a 25-16 victory in the third set and finished the match off with a 25-23 triumph in the fourth.</p>

<p>Pella also earned its 3-1 win against Norwalk. The Dutch took Set 1, 25-22, before Norwalk took down an epic second set, 31-29. </p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>To its credit, Pella picked itself up after that emotional setback. The Dutch grabbed Set 3, 25-17, and finished off the match with a 25-21 decision in the fourth set. </p>
